Context: What Is the Clarity Act, and Why Should You Care?

The Clarity Act — officially the "Digital Asset Clarity Act" — is a U.S. federal bill that aims to classify certain digital assets as commodities rather than securities, handing primary oversight to the CFTC instead of the SEC. It's been kicking around since late 2023, introduced by pro-crypto Congressman Tom Emmer. The bill has bipartisan support, but its passage is far from guaranteed, especially in a politically charged election year.

The Solana Policy Institute (SPI) is a 501(c)(4) nonprofit funded by the Solana Foundation. Its job is advocacy, not engineering. So when SPI issues a warning, it's not talking about Solana's technical performance — it's talking about the regulatory weather system that surrounds the entire Solana ecosystem.
